软件开发资讯

可视化编程(visual):通过图形界面和拖放组件来创建应用程序的编程方式

可视化编程是一种软件开发方法,它允许开发者通过图形化界面和直观的工具来构建应用程序,而不仅仅是依赖于传统的文本编辑器编写代码。这种方法极大地简化了编程过程,提高了开发效率,并使得非专业程序员也能参与到应用程序的创建中。以下是对可视化编程的详细解释,包括其定义、特点、优势以及一个实例讲解。一、可视化编程的定义可视化编程是一种编程范式,它通过使用图形元素(如按钮、文本框、菜单等)和可视化工具(如拖放功

zone(n.区域):通常用于描述特定的范围、管理区域或数据中心的位置等

Zone(区域)在软件开发中是一个重要的概念,它通常用于描述特定的范围、管理区域或数据中心的位置等。以下是对Zone(区域)的详细解释,并结合一个实例进行形象讲解。一、Zone(区域)的定义与分类Zone(区域)在软件开发中可以有多重含义,但通常指的是一个特定的管理范围或地理位置。以下是对Zone(区域)在软件开发中的几种主要分类:数据中心区域:区域(Region):指物理的数据中心,每个区域完全

知识付费小程序开发方案(手把手教你快速建立自己的知识付费小程序)

知识付费小程序作为知识变现的有效途径之一,为知识创作者提供了一个便捷的平台。本文将介绍知识付费小程序的概念和优势,并深入分析知识付费小程序搭建前的准备工作和搭建流程,帮助知识创作者快速建立自己的知识付费小程序。一、知识付费小程序介绍知识付费小程序是基于小程序平台的一种应用,旨在让知识创作者将自己的知识进行变现。它提供了订阅、付费课程、知识分享等功能,允许用户通过付费获取独家知识内容。知识付费小程序

basic(adj.基本的)

在软件开发领域,"basic"作为形容词,其含义是“基本的”或“基础的”。这个词在软件开发中非常重要,因为它涉及到软件开发的各个方面,从编程语言的基础语法到软件架构的基本设计原则。以下是对"basic"在软件开发中的详细解释,结合一个实例进行形象讲解。一、基本释义在软件开发中,"basic"通常指的是那些构成软件开发基础的知识、技能、概念或工具。这些基础知识是进一步学习和掌握高级技能的前提,也是确

编译型语言(compiled language)::在编译阶段将源代码转换为机器代码

编译型语言,作为软件开发领域中的一个核心概念,是指那些在执行之前需要将源代码转换成机器码(即计算机可直接理解和执行的指令集)的编程语言。这一过程通常由专门的编译器来完成,编译器是一种将高级编程语言源代码转换为机器码的软件工具。以下是对编译型语言的详细解释,包括其定义、工作原理、特点、优势、劣势以及一个具体的实例讲解。一、定义编译型语言,顾名思义,是指在程序运行之前,需要先将源代码通过编译器一次性转

数据质量(Data Quality):确保数据准确性和可靠性

数据质量是软件开发、数据分析以及数据科学领域中一个至关重要的概念。它关乎到数据的准确性、完整性、一致性、时效性等多个方面,是确保数据能够可靠地用于决策、分析和预测的基础。以下将从数据质量的定义、核心要素、评估标准、实例讲解以及提升策略等方面,对其进行全面而深入的解析。一、数据质量的定义数据质量是指在业务环境下,数据符合数据消费者的使用目的,能满足业务场景具体需求的程度。它涵盖了数据的多个方面,包括

bubble(n.冒泡)

在软件开发领域,“bubble”(冒泡)这一术语具有多重含义,但最为人所熟知的可能是冒泡排序算法(Bubble Sort)以及在某些特定上下文中,如数据可视化或软件开发平台中,“bubble”可能指代气泡图界面元素或类似的概念。以下是对“bubble”这一软件开发词汇的详细解释,并附带一个形象的实例讲解。冒泡排序算法(Bubble Sort)冒泡排序是一种简单的排序算法,其基本思想是重复地遍历待排

Team Topologies(团队拓扑) - 定义高效研发团队结构的理论模型

在当今竞争激烈的软件开发领域,团队效率的高低直接影响着项目的成败。如何构建一个高效的研发团队结构,成为众多企业关注的焦点。Team Topologies(团队拓扑)作为一种新兴的理论模型,为解决这一问题提供了有效的思路。Team Topologies:理论基础与核心概念Team Topologies由Matthew Skelton和Manuel Pais提出,它是一种描述软件开发团队组织的模型。该

app软件开发制作公司有哪些创新理念(用户至上·创新驱动·持续迭代)

在移动互联网时代,App软件开发制作公司正以前所未有的速度推动着技术的革新与应用,为用户提供更加丰富、便捷和智能的服务。在这个竞争激烈的市场环境中,如何脱颖而出,成为用户心中的首选?关键在于秉持用户至上、创新驱动、持续迭代的三大创新理念。一、用户至上:以用户为核心,打造极致体验用户至上,是App软件开发制作公司的核心价值观。在这个用户为王的时代,只有深入了解用户需求,提供满足甚至超越用户期望的产品

软件开发公司能否按时完成项目并交付高质量的产品?(满足定制化与快速迭代需求)

在当今快速变化的商业环境中,软件开发项目的时间表和品质要求日益严格。企业对于软件开发公司的期望,不仅仅是按时完成项目,更在于交付高质量的产品,以满足其定制化需求和快速迭代的能力。本文旨在探讨软件开发公司如何确保项目按时交付,同时保持产品的高质量,以满足客户的期望。一、高效的项目管理与执行软件开发公司能否按时完成项目,关键在于其项目管理的效率。一个成熟的项目管理团队,会采用敏捷开发、Scrum等先进